Located on Pisa's attractive main shopping street, Salza cake shop and chocolatier has been delighting Pisans since 1898. Try a piece of the local speciality cake, torta co' bischeri, or buy a chocolate leaning tower to take home (46 Borgo Stretto, tel: 050 580 144, salza.it).

Just east of Pisa, the medieval town of San Miniato has a charming centre that's well worth exploring. There are beautiful views of the surrounding countryside and some fabulous eateries (such as Osteria Upupa), where you can try the famous local truffle.
